              • Aatif.. The reverse trip will take a toll on your body.. Remember you are going from 8000ft altitude to 15000ft and then back to 10K all in a matter of few 'tiring' nights. Not impossible, but completely avoidable no?

                Also if you are so hell bend on climbing from Manali, why not visit Pangong before, and then go to leh, and then Diskit, and then Leh to Kaagil

                  Are you planning to go via Wari La? Couple of things you need to take care of:
                  1. The pass might not open.
                  2. You will have a long distance to be covered between two fuel stops (Leh to Leh).

                  If I was you, I would leave Mumbai on Fri eve itself. Ride till midnight/till I feel sleepy.
                  Will directly go towards Srinagar and proceed to Leh via Srinagar and return via Delhi. Let me know if you want me to share the route that I would do.

                  Originally posted by satyenpoojary View Post
                  Also if you are so hell bend on climbing from Manali, why not visit Pangong before, and then go to leh, and then Diskit, and then Leh to Kaagil
                  To visit Pangong we need permit, available in Leh.
                  Also, in case fuel station at Karu isn't functional, they will have to either carry fuel from Tandi or goto Leh to tankup.
                  Also they would reach Pangong by evening and all the acco's near lake might be already taken up, so they would have to stay at either Tangste or Spangmik.

                          • Originally posted by aatifs View Post


                            Day 9 : June 17th(Sunday)
                            I hope you have not planned to go through Agham route for Day 9 as that route is unknown, not advisable and may not be open.

                            Rather plan Diskit - Leh - Karu - Pangong Tso which is safe.

                            Also, It would have been much better to acclimatize to high altitude if you would start from Srinagar route and come via Manali.

                            I see Rohtang as a challenge as it would be full of slush mud and to climb this pass would definitely be tuff so be prepared. Ride Safe!
